Sadly, two former V-League champions are struggling to avoid relegation: Can they escape together?

The race to stay in the V-League 2024 - 2025 is currently a three-way battle between three teams from the Central region: Quang Nam Club, Da Nang Club and Binh Dinh Club. Sadly, the two teams from Quang Nam, both former champions, are now in a difficult situation together.

Once a land that produced teams with personality, rich identity and ambition, now football in the Central region is falling into a tragic moment. As the 2024 - 2025 V-League season enters its final stage, the 3 teams of this strip of land, Quang Nam , Da Nang and Binh Dinh, are caught in a fierce relegation race. In particular, the competition between Quang Nam Club and Da Nang Club is something that fans of Quang Nam do not want at all.

Da Nang FC, with two V-League championships (2009 and 2012), is the pride of the land on the banks of the Han River. The 2024-2025 season has just returned after a year of fighting in the first division, but has once again fallen into the old spiral. Meanwhile, Quang Nam FC (V-League champion 2017) is not doing much better, as the golden years are now deep in the past. The two neighboring teams from Quang Nam, both former champions of the V-League, are now in a difficult situation, together clinging to the hope of staying in the highest football playground in Vietnam.

Although Quang Nam Club and Da Nang Club do not directly clash in the final round, they are both fighting for the same goal. Up to now, Quang Nam Club (currently with 25 points) has the most advantage, when coach Van Sy Son and his team only need a draw at HAGL's Pleiku Stadium in round 26 to reach the finish line safely.

Meanwhile, Da Nang FC (currently with 22 points) must win against SLNA in the final round, and wait for Quang Nam to lose to HAGL. Only then can the Han River team escape relegation. If this happens, the two Quang Nam teams will both have 25 points, but Da Nang FC will be ranked higher thanks to their better head-to-head record.

Although the prospect of both Quang Nam and Da Nang clubs appearing together in the V-League next season is unlikely to come true, it is not impossible. In the event that one team successfully stays in the league, and the other team wins the play-off, the stands at Hoa Xuan and Tam Ky stadiums will be crowded every weekend.

But it should be added that the above scenarios can only happen if Da Nang FC wins against SLNA in the final round, or the Han River team is not surpassed by Binh Dinh FC (currently with 21 points) on the rankings.
